Are these mounts compatible with all Mini Cooper models?

Compatibility varies by mount and Mini model. Some mounts fit F54–F60 generation cars. Others target Gen2 R55–R61. Check the product fit list before buying. I always confirm model years before installation.

Will a MagSafe iPhone work without an adapter?

Yes, MagSafe iPhones attach directly to magnetic mounts. Non-MagSafe phones need a metal plate or case adapter. I recommend a thin magnetic case for consistent alignment and charging.

Do these mounts damage the Mini Cooper interior?

Most mounts are designed to avoid damage. I use soft pads and follow manufacturer notes to prevent scratches. Install and remove carefully. If you are unsure, test on a small area or consult a pro.

Can I charge my phone while using the mount?

Many mounts support wireless charging or allow a charging cable to reach your device. The Dual Magnetic Magsafe Charger supports 15W wireless charging. For wired charging, route a cable to the mount for a snug and tidy setup.

How secure are these mounts on rough roads?

Security depends on design. Dashboard and tachometer mounts performed well in my tests. Magnetic mounts held strong with MagSafe devices. For rugged use, choose mounts with firm clamps and rubber padding to reduce slip and vibration.
